X Square Robot, a pioneering developer of embodied AI and foundation models, has announced the successful completion of four consecutive financing rounds. This monumental achievement brings the company's valuation to over $2.8 billion, solidifying its position as a leader in the AI industry.
Founded in 2023, X Square Robot has been at the forefront of developing end-to-end embodied AI systems. Unlike traditional rule-based automation, the company's approach enables robots to adapt to changing environments and generalize across a wide range of tasks. This innovative technology has the potential to transform various industries, including household, industrial, and logistics scenarios.
The financing rounds have brought together a coalition of strategic and financial investors, including prominent technology companies, industrial partners, and venture capital firms. IDG participated in the Series C round, while HongShan and Xiaomi have provided backing in multiple previous rounds.
X Square Robot's system combines foundation models, robotics hardware, a proprietary data-pipeline system, and real-world deployments. At its core is a general-purpose embodied AI model designed to enable robots to perceive, reason, and act in complex physical environments. The company has made significant strides in this area, introducing WALL-B, a foundation model built on its World Unified Model architecture.
WALL-B trains perception, language, action, and physical prediction within a unified network, enabling stronger multimodal understanding, spatial reasoning, and continual learning from real-world interactions. X Square Robot has also open-sourced WALL-OSS-0.5 and WALL-WM, extending its unified approach to robot manipulation and world modeling.
The company's scalable, model-driven data pipeline has been instrumental in accelerating model development. By combining automated data collection, cleaning, annotation, quality control, and augmentation, X Square Robot has created a system that enables rapid model iteration while generating high-quality datasets for complex, long-tail scenarios.
X Square Robot is deploying its model and hardware stack across various scenarios, including household settings. The company has partnered with 58.com to launch an AI-powered cleaning service in Shenzhen and Beijing, where robots work alongside people in real residential environments. This initiative marks a significant step towards the adoption and deployment of embodied AI in everyday life.
